Here, for example, compare the speed of capturing cities by the purple faction in the Polish version (taken from Dandy's walkthrough saves), and in the English version, which I'm currently trying to play (pictures 1, 2, 3, 4, 5).*
In the Polish version, he captures the third castle on 3.4.4, on 6.4.6 he still has only 3 castles, he captures the fourth on 6.4.7, and the last one only on 7.2.2.*
In the English version, the third castle is captured on 1.3.6, and by 3.2.1, the purple faction has already captured all the castles! That's quite a difference.*
Or here, the capture of resources by the orange faction (pictures 6, 7, 8). In the Polish version, on 3.1.5, he has only just opened the passage to the first resource zone. In the English version, this happens on 1.4.4, on 2.3.3 all the resources are already captured, and by the end of the 3rd month, 4 castles are captured, and the first two are already fully built. So, in the English version, it is extremely desirable to cut off the orange faction's resources as early as possible.*
